Over 100 School Employees Lose Jobs in Serbia Since New Education Minister Appointed
More than 100 school employees in Serbia have lost their jobs, and over 110 disciplinary proceedings have been initiated against teachers since Dejan Stanković was appointed Minister of Education. This report comes from the SRCE organization.
